Beautifully illustrated with over 84 full-color photographs of stunning and rare masks, instruments, and costumes from the late 1800s to early 1900s, this catalog was published in 2019 for MIM’s special exhibition, Congo Masks and Music: Masterpieces from Central Africa. The catalog also includes archival photography and text written by the exhibition’s curators, Manuel Jordán, PhD, MIM’s deputy director and chief curator, and Marc Felix, MIM board of directors member and international expert on African art.

Congo Masks and Music explored the connections between masks and musical instruments and reflected the diverse settings of masquerades. Masquerades take place for a variety of reasons—to educate, entertain, demonstrate power, and connect humans with the spirit world.
